NORT: - Rodents tend to interact more with a novel object than with a familiar object. A trait exploited the object-recognition task. Subjects are placed in an area and allowed to explore an object. Following this exploration the subject is returned to its home cage for a given interval. The subject is then returned to the apparatus, now containing the previously encountered familiar object and a novel object. Object recognition is distinguished by more time spent interacting with the novel object. This method has been used to study cognition in response to various genetic, pharmacological and environmental manipulations.
